How a Backend Developer Can Optimize the Inventory Management System for Your Streetwear Dropshipping Store to Handle High Traffic During Product Launches
The streetwear dropshipping market is defined by rapid sales spikes during exclusive product launches. High traffic and simultaneous purchase attempts create enormous pressure on your inventory management system. Without backend optimization, you risk overselling, site crashes, slow checkout, and customer dissatisfaction. A backend developer specializes in designing scalable, resilient systems that ensure your inventory stays accurate and responsive—especially during these critical launch moments.
1. Designing Scalable Infrastructure to Handle Traffic Surges
Backend developers build scalable inventory management systems capable of sustaining huge influxes of visitors typical during streetwear drops.
Load Balancing and Horizontal Scaling: By deploying load balancers and multiple servers, backend teams distribute incoming requests efficiently, preventing single points of failure and downtime. See AWS Elastic Load Balancing for robust service options.
Auto-scaling Cloud Resources: Leveraging cloud platforms such as AWS Auto Scaling, Google Cloud Autoscaler, or Azure Autoscale ensures your inventory system dynamically scales compute resources up or down based on real-time demand.
Caching Layers: Integrating fast in-memory caches like Redis or Memcached dramatically reduces database load by storing frequently accessed data such as product stock levels and prices.
Asynchronous Processing: Using message queues like RabbitMQ or task queues such as Celery defers non-essential processes (email notifications, analytics updates) to background workers, freeing main threads for inventory queries and checkout.
This scalable foundation ensures your store won’t buckle under the massive and unpredictable demand during drops.
2. Real-Time Inventory Synchronization with Suppliers’ Systems
Since dropshipping means relying on external suppliers’ stock, backend developers implement real-time synchronization to prevent overselling limited streetwear items.
API Integration: Custom APIs or middleware connect your store with multiple suppliers’ inventory systems. Backend devs program scheduled polling or webhook listeners to receive instant updates to stock levels.
Conflict Management: Logic enforcing transactional integrity prevents race conditions where simultaneous purchases exceed available inventory.
Graceful Fallbacks: If supplier APIs are unreachable, the system serves cached inventory data or imposes protective buffers to avoid overselling.
Inventory Buffering: Developers set buffer thresholds to temporarily suspend sales on borderline stock until confirmations arrive, reducing cancellations.
Learn more about building robust API inventory sync systems.
3. Intelligent Stock Allocation and Prioritization Algorithms
Backend systems can smartly allocate tiny streetwear inventory batches across multiple channels (website, marketplaces) and user demand pools.
Demand Forecasting Integration: Incorporate analytics and customer behavior to prioritize high-demand SKUs for fulfillment.
Multi-Channel Stock Splitting: Prevent inventory clashes by dividing stock intelligently among sales channels.
Managing Pre-orders & Backorders: Backend logic tracks supplier lead times to allow waitlists or preorder sales without overselling.
Dynamic Stock Adjustment: Near-real-time recalculation of stock availability based on pending carts, abandoned sessions, and purchase velocity.
These techniques improve fill rates, prevent stockouts, and maximize sales during short-lived drops.
4. Optimizing the Checkout Process for High Concurrency
Checkout bottlenecks directly impact conversion during hype-driven drops. Backend developers focus on:
Atomic Transactions: Ensuring inventory decrement, payment authorization (e.g., via Stripe API), and order creation happen as a single atomic operation to prevent inconsistencies.
Session Persistence: Retaining cart data across page reloads and sessions prevents cart loss from transient connection issues.
Low-Latency APIs: Optimized database queries and minimized payload sizes speed up checkout APIs.
Queue Management: When traffic peaks threaten overload, queueing systems limit concurrent checkout attempts, providing smooth and fair access.
Clear Error Messaging: Backend-driven user feedback on inventory changes or payment failures fosters trust and reduces abandonment.
Implementing these backend checkout optimizations converts hype into real sales efficiently.
5. Real-Time Monitoring and Analytics Dashboards
Backend developers implement comprehensive monitoring systems to track inventory, server health, and user behavior live.
Inventory Tracking: SKU-level stock and supplier availability display in real time.
Performance Metrics: Monitor API response times, error rates, and system load.
User Behavior Analytics: Capture cart abandonment, conversion rates, and product popularity on the fly.
Alerts and Notifications: Automated alerts trigger for low stock, integration failures, or suspicious activity (bots/scalpers).
Tools like Prometheus and Grafana enable customized dashboards for instant insight.
6. Automating Order Fulfillment and Customer Communication
Automate the full lifecycle of dropshipping order management to maintain fast, accurate fulfillment and customer satisfaction.
Instant Supplier Order Confirmation: Backend API calls or electronic data interchange (EDI) relay order details immediately.
Real-Time Fulfillment Updates: Track shipment status and notify customers proactively.
Refund and Cancellation Handling: Automate stock restoration and customer refunds if suppliers cannot fulfill.
Inventory Updates: Automatically adjust stock and release holds as orders progress or cancel.
This end-to-end automation reduces errors and latency while enhancing the customer experience.
7. API-First Architecture Enables Flexibility and Rapid Integrations
Backend developers often adopt an API-first design, exposing inventory management and order processing functions via secure APIs.
Seamless Supplier & Channel Integrations: Easily onboard new suppliers, marketplaces (e.g., Shopify API), or sales platforms without major refactoring.
Frontend Decoupling: Optimize user experience with fast React or Vue apps consuming backend APIs.
Third-Party Tools Integration: Connect analytics, automation, or engagement tools like Zigpoll to gather real-time customer feedback during drops, guiding inventory adjustments.
8. Rate Limiting and Bot Protection to Secure Inventory
Scalpers and bots can disproportionately drain limited inventory. Backend defenses include:
API Rate Limiting: Cap requests per IP/token using frameworks like express-rate-limit.
CAPTCHA Implementation: Add challenges to block automated checkouts.
Web Application Firewalls (WAF): Use services such as Cloudflare Bot Management or AWS WAF to detect malicious traffic.
Real-Time Bot Detection: Anomaly monitoring to identify and block suspicious patterns quickly.
These measures ensure genuine customers get fair access to coveted drops.
9. Database Optimization for High-Concurrency Inventory Management
Efficient database design reduces latency and maintains integrity when high traffic hits.
Indexing: Optimize queries on SKU, stock, and order tables.
Sharding & Partitioning: Split large datasets across multiple nodes to distribute load effectively.
Optimistic Locking: Prevent overselling with controlled concurrency on inventory updates.
NoSQL & In-Memory Databases: Utilize stores like Redis for ultra-fast cache of top-selling products.
Master database tuning strategies to support heavy transactional throughput.
10. Performance Testing and Load Simulation Before Launch
Benchmark your inventory backend well before product drops.
Load Testing Tools: Use JMeter, Locust, or Gatling to simulate thousands of concurrent users adding to carts and checking out.
Stress Testing Inventory Synchronization: Validate API reliability and caching layer responsiveness under pressure.
Identify Bottlenecks Early: Use test data to optimize server configurations and caching parameters.
Continuous testing ensures readiness for hyped streetwear launch traffic.
Additional Recommended Tools and Resources
AWS Auto Scaling - Manage dynamic backend capacity.
Redis Cache - Fast caching layer for inventory queries.
RabbitMQ Messaging - Asynchronous task queue.
Cloudflare Bot Management - Protect against scalpers and bots.
Stripe API - Reliable payment integrations.
Shopify API - Marketplace integrations.
Zigpoll - Real-time customer feedback during drops.
Conclusion: Empower Your Streetwear Dropshipping Store with Backend Expertise
Optimizing your inventory management system for high-traffic streetwear drops requires deep backend development skills. From scalable infrastructure and real-time supplier synchronization to intelligent stock allocation and bot protection, backend developers ensure your system can withstand launch day surges.
Strategic backend optimization minimizes overselling, maximizes uptime, accelerates checkout, and delivers seamless customer experiences that convert hype into revenue consistently. Partnering with experienced backend developers transforms your store's technology into a powerful asset that thrives through every high-pressure product drop.
For more on scaling your streetwear dropshipping backend and enhancing launch readiness, explore AWS Auto Scaling, Redis, and Cloudflare Bot Management. To elevate customer engagement during drops, integrate Zigpoll feedback collection in real time.